In the current study, Al-substituted cobalt ferrite nanoparticles (NPs), CoFe2–xAlxO4, were synthesized by co-precipitation method. X-ray diffraction patterns for all the prepared ferrite samples confirmed the formation of single-phase cubic spinel structure. The FT-IR spectra show two foremost fundamental absorption bands ranging from about 450 to 600 cm−1. The FE-SEM images confirm the formation of nearly spherical ferrite NPs with an average size of about 25–30 nm. The characteristic feature of magnetic hysteresis loops exhibits the ferrimagnetic nature of all samples. The coercivity of CoFe2O4 NPs decreases from 602 Oe to minimum 180 Oe corresponding to Al concentration of x = 0.4. Saturation magnetization values decreases from 81.7 to 26 emu/g and nB decreases from 3.43 to 0.98 μB almost linearly by increasing Al content.
